With the second annual Code Conference only days away, Re/code’s co-executive editors Kara Swisher and Walt Mossberg are once again preparing to put leading figures from the tech industry and beyond into the hot seat, or at least the red chair.
In the video above, they highlight the key themes they’re looking forward to exploring, including diversity, disruption, the rise of Chinese tech companies and the evolution of mobile into other spheres.
The three-day event will feature top executives from Airbnb, Apple, BuzzFeed, CBS, GM, Google, Snapchat, Sprint, Target and more. It kicks off on May 26 at the Terranea Resort in Rancho Palos Verdes, Calif.
